Assertion(A): The maximum covalency of Si and Ge is 6 but that of carbon is 4.
Reason (R): Due to the presence of d-orbitals in Si and Ge, both these elements can undergo \(\mathrm{sp}^3 \mathrm{~d}^2\) hybridisation and covalency of 6 is possible. Carbon has no d-orbitals in it and hence its covalency is 4.
The correct answer is:
- A (A) and (R) are correct and (R) is the correct explanation of \((\mathrm{A})\)
- B (A) and (R) are correct but \((\mathrm{R})\) is not the correct explanation of \((\mathrm{A})\)
- C (A) is correct but \((\mathrm{R})\) is not correct
- D (A) is not correct but (R) is correct
Answer & Solution
Correct Answer
(A) (A) and (R) are correct and (R) is the correct explanation of \((\mathrm{A})\)
